Full Mouth Rehabilitation is a comprehensive treatment plan that restores or replaces all the teeth in your mouth to achieve optimal oral health, function, and aesthetics. It’s not just a cosmetic makeover — it’s a structural and functional transformation that helps patients chew better, speak clearly, and smile confidently again.

As we age, years of chewing, grinding (bruxism), or misalignment gradually wear down the enamel — flattening the teeth and reducing vertical height.
This can lead to:
Rehabilitation restores the lost height, corrects the bite, and gives your face a rejuvenated look.
Frequent consumption of acidic foods, soft drinks, or gastric reflux can erode enamel, making teeth thinner and more yellow.
This causes:
Through full mouth rehabilitation, eroded teeth can be rebuilt using high-strength ceramic restorations or composite overlays — protecting them from further acid damage.
In areas with naturally high fluoride in water, enamel may develop white, brown, or chalky patches — known as dental fluorosis.
While mild fluorosis is mainly aesthetic, severe forms can cause:
We address these concerns with ceramic veneers, crowns, or composite restorations to restore smoothness, uniform color, and natural brilliance.
When teeth don’t meet properly during biting or grinding, it creates uneven pressure — leading to cracks, mobility, and even bone loss over time.
FMR corrects this imbalance to restore harmony between teeth, muscles, and joints, ensuring long-term comfort and stability.
